Singlefile Wines Denmark Family Reserve Chardonnay 2016




Downright delicious and classy. A super Chardy from Denmark in Western Australia!

Planted in 1989, the vineyard is 60 metres above sea level. The vineyard is a very slow ripening and tends to maintain its natural acidity while developing ripeness.

This fruit was harvested by hand, whole bunch pressed and fermented in 40% new and 60% one year old French oak barriques. The wine spent eight months in oak with partial MLF (approx 18%).

Ticking all the boxes, immerse yourself in lime leaf, white fleshed stone fruit and juicy grapefruit. Generosity is a hallmark of this wine - handfuls of fruit are lobbed at you before layers of toasted almonds and vanilla cream are wrapped up by balanced finely etched acidity. Big love.

Drink now to ten years.

94/100

Region: Denmark
RRP: $50
